Head Chef Salary in Sparks, NV
Head Chefs in Sparks, NV, in 2025, earn approximately $48.02 per hour, which is about $1,920.80 per week, $8,323.47 per month, and $99,881.60 per year.
The job market for Head Chefs in Sparks is experiencing a positive growth rate of 5% per year, indicating increasing demand and opportunities in the culinary industry within the area.
How Much Does a Head Chef Make in Sparks, NV?
The salary for a Head Chef in Sparks, NV varies based on experience, qualifications, and establishment type. Here's a breakdown of earnings by experience levels:
| Experience level | Hourly pay | Weekly pay | Monthly pay | Yearly pay |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Entry-level (~25th percentile) | $42.00 | $1,680.00 | $7,280.00 | $87,360.00 |
| Mid-level (average) | $48.02 | $1,920.80 | $8,323.47 | $99,881.60 |
| Top earners (90th percentile) | $55.00 | $2,200.00 | $9,533.33 | $114,400.00 |
Do Head Chefs in Sparks Earn Tips?
Head Chefs in Sparks generally do not earn tips as their role focuses on kitchen management and food preparation rather than direct customer service. Their compensation typically relies solely on salary or wages.
Head Chef Salary in Sparks vs. National Average
Nationally, Head Chefs make on average about $30.26 per hour and $62,940.80 annually.
Comparatively, Head Chefs in Sparks earn significantly more, with an average hourly wage of $48.02 and yearly salary around $99,881.60, reflecting local market conditions and possibly higher living costs.

How To Become a Head Chef in Sparks
Becoming a successful Head Chef involves a combination of education, experience, and certifications:
- Formal Culinary Education: Programs like the Truckee Meadows Community College Culinary Arts Program offer practical and theoretical training vital for aspiring chefs.
- Advanced Courses: The University of Nevada, Reno Extended Studies Culinary Program provides professional development opportunities focused on advanced culinary techniques.
- Food Safety Certification: Earning the ServSafe Food Protection Manager Certification demonstrates essential knowledge in food safety and handling.
- Professional Certification: The American Culinary Federation (ACF) Certification validates a chef’s culinary skills and expertise.
